GBDS Configuration

Configuration File

The GBDS configuration parameters are defined in a configuration file containing all parameters and their respective values. Parameters that are omitted assume their default values. This section describes the properties of the configuration file.

This document is updated for GBDS version 4.6.9.

File Location

The configuration file is located at: /etc/griaule/conf/gbds/application.conf.

File Properties

The configuration file must follow some requirements so that it can be correctly interpreted by GBDS. These requirements are:

  1. The file name and its location must be exactly the same as described in the section File Location

  2. There must be only one configuration parameter per line.

  3. Each configuration parameter must have the form {parameter}={value}, without line breaks;

  4. Each value must be separated by a comma when assigned to the same parameter.

singleton-proxy.buffer-size

If the singleton's location is unknown, the proxy will store the number of messages defined in this parameter in a buffer and deliver them when the singleton is identified. When the buffer is full, the oldest messages will be discarded and new messages will be sent by the proxy.

Default Value:

1000

Possible Values:

1 to 10000

gbds.cluster.kafka.max-tasks-per-poll

Number of tasks performed in Kafka in each poll. Task consumption in Kafka is done by polling the queue, and the poll retrieves a certain number of records each time. Each record is a task in GBDS. This setting limits how many records are fetched per poll.

Default Value:

1

Possible Values:

1 to 1000

gbds.rdb.maxStatments

This parameter defines the size of c3p0's global PreparedStatement cache. If both gbds.rdb.maxStatments and gbds.rdb.maxStatementsPerConnection are zero, the statement caching will not be enabled. If gbds.rdb.maxStatments is zero, but gbds.rdb.maxStatementsPerConnection is nonzero, the statement caching will be enabled, but no global limit will be enforced, only the per-connection maximum.

This parameter controls the total number of statements cached for all connections. If greater than zero, it should be a significantly large number, since each pooled connection requires its own distinct set of statements in cache. As a guideline, consider how many distinct PreparedStatements are frequently used in your application, then multiply that number by gbds.rdb.maxPoolSize to arrive at an appropriate value.

Default Value:

0

gbds.rdb.maxIdleTime

This parameter defines, in seconds, how long a connection may be pooled but unused before being discarded. Zero means idle connections never expire.

Default Value:

1800

gbds.rdb.maxConnectionAge

This parameter defines, in seconds, the lifetime of a connection. A connection older than gbds.rdb.maxConnectionAge will be destroyed and removed from the pool. This differs from gbds.rdb.maxIdleTime because it refers to absolute age. Even a connection that hasn't been very idle will be removed from the pool if it exceeds gbds.rdb.maxConnectionAge. Zero means no absolute maximum age is applied.

Default Value:

1800

gbds.rdb.statementCacheNumDeferredCloseThreads

If configured with a value greater than 0, the statement cache will track when connections are in use and only destroy the statements when their parent Connections are not in use. Although closing a statement while the parent connection is in use is formally within specifications, some databases and/or JDBC drivers, most notably Oracle, do not handle the case well and hang, leading to deadlocks. Setting this parameter to a positive value should eliminate the problem. This parameter should only be set if you observe c3p0 attempts to close() the statements cached ones hang (typically, you will see APPARENT DEADLOCKS in your logs). If set, this parameter should almost always be set to 1.

Default Value:

1

gbds.rdb.testConnectionOnCheckout

If true, an operation will be performed on each connection checkout to check whether the connection is valid. Testing connections on checkout is the simplest and most reliable form of connection testing, but for better performance consider testing connections periodically using gbds.rdb.idleConnectionTestPeriod.

Default Value:

false

Possible Values:

  • true

  • false

gbds.rdb.testConnectionOnCheckin

If true, an operation will be performed asynchronously on each connection checkin to verify whether the connection is valid. Use in combination with gbds.rdb.idleConnectionTestPeriod for an always-asynchronous and quite reliable connection test.

Default Value:

true

Possible Values:

  • true

  • false

gbds.rdb.acquireRetryAttempts

Defines how many times c3p0 will attempt to acquire a new connection from the database before giving up. If this value is less than or equal to zero, c3p0 will keep trying to obtain a connection indefinitely.

Default Value:

10

gbds.rdb.idleConnectionTestPeriod

If this number is greater than 0, c3p0 will test all idle, unchecked connections in the pool every number of seconds defined by this parameter.

Default Value:

30

Template Serializer Configuration

This section describes configuration parameters related to the template serializer. These configuration parameters are designed to allow the use of the GBDS Batch Extractor.

circle-info

See the GBDS Batch Extractor manual for additional information on its use.

Whenever GBDS performs a cold boot, it will attempt to recover templates from a default column family. If the template does not exist in that column, GBDS will attempt to recover it from the fallback column family.

The serializer configuration parameters are:

Default Column Family

These parameters are divided by biometric modalities. Templates in this column family are not encoded and the format used is byteArray.

The default value for these parameters is tpt.

Fallback Column Family

These parameters refer to the column families previously used to store biometric templates. They are separated by biometric modality.

The default values represent the column families used before the change of these parameters, and are, respectively: fingerprints, palmprints, faces and iris.

Fallback encoding in base64

The fallback column family supports encoding. The following parameters define whether the column family is base64 encoded. base64:

The default value for these parameters is true.

gbds.template.memory.format

Defines how GBDS will store templates in memory and in the matchers.

The options are:

  • DESERIALIZED_FULL: Default option. Templates are stored deserialized with minutiae and segments.

  • SERIALIZED_MINUTIAE_SEGMENTS: Templates are stored deserialized with minutiae and segments.

  • SERIALIZED_MINUTIAE: Templates are stored serialized with minutiae only. Segments are re-extracted from the template for each search performed. This option increases 1:N search time.

  • OPTIMIZED: Uses a new optimized template format to reduce performance degradation over time in searches.

Memory pre-allocation

Defines the amount of pre-allocated memory for each modality.

The default value for each configuration is 0. The system understands Kilobytes (k, kb), Megabytes (m, mb) and Gigabytes (g, gb), case-insensitively. The value is divided equally among all the node's matchers.

circle-info

Face and iris cannot be pre-allocated.
